Page 3: Alf Scambler Aggreko presentation All Energy 2016

Background to Solution

• Aggreko supplied Power and Load packages to commission Renewables Projects for many years.

• Started in North America with onshore wind, UK in 2009.• Work mainly with equipment manufacturers and developers• Options

– LV supply to keep turbines healthy.– LV static commissioning– HV keeping multiple turbines healthy from single connection

point. – HV rotational commissioning at each turbine.– HV rotational commissioning at single connection point with

multiple turbines running.

Page 5: Alf Scambler Aggreko presentation All Energy 2016

Commissioning Solutions

1) Low voltage solution to do basic commissioning and keep turbines healthy.

2) High voltage solution from central point to enable static commissioning to be completed and keep all turbines healthy.

3) High voltage solution to offer full rotational commissioning of the turbines a) At the base of each turbine b) From a central connection point.

3b offers the most flexible solution. All turbines can be powered up and multiple turbines can be tested simultaneously.

Page 13: Alf Scambler Aggreko presentation All Energy 2016

Grid outages or equipment failure

• O&M phase– Planned or unplanned grid outages, equipment can be kept

healthy from the site HV network enabling maintenance, preservation of warranty and early resumption of power export to grid.

• Failure of transformers or switchgear– Failure of turbine transformer – no export from single turbine.– Failure of export transformer

• no export of power from site• no power to turbine ancillaries.

• Replacement equipment is available to enable business continuity and earn revenue.

Page 18: Alf Scambler Aggreko presentation All Energy 2016

Innovation – Auto load control(Solar and Wind)

• Manual load matching to Solar output almost impossible• Large power package required to match the solar

generation output.• Load applied to generators from loadbank to match the

likely output from the solar array.• Fuel burn large during periods of low solar output.• Wind Farms, due to their slower ramp rate, are more

manageable under manual operation but require manpower to control.

• Fuel and manpower are significant costs to a commissioning project.

18

Page 19: Alf Scambler Aggreko presentation All Energy 2016

Solution

• Auto load control!• Aggreko have developed an automated load control system for

their commissioning solutions• Can control the fast ramp rate of a solar farm and the slower

ramp rate of a wind farm.• Can be used equally on small scale or large scale projects.• Can be used on other technologies, wave, tidal, etc.• Can also be used to control grid export power under a limited

grid point connection.

Page 22: Alf Scambler Aggreko presentation All Energy 2016

Benefits

• Keeps power package to a minimum – lower rental costs.• Keeps fuel burn to a minimum – lower fuel costs.• Runs automatically – after commissioning requires minimum

manual intervention – lower manpower costs• System stability improved• Load ramping can be matched to suit technology• If high number of turbines and hence large ancillary load,

turbine(s) can be run to reduce load on generator to supply the base load.

• Results in a cost effective commissioning solution!
